Stryker Sonopet iQ Serrated Large Tip for Ultrasonic Soft Tissue Resection
The Stryker Sonopet iQ Serrated Large Tip (item #5500-25S-316) is a 12cm ultrasonic soft tissue resection accessory designed for rapid and aggressive fragmentation of tough or fibrous tissues. Its serrated profile enhances cutting efficiency while maintaining control, making it ideal for neurosurgical, spinal, and ENT procedures where fast, effective soft tissue removal is critical.
Product Code: 5500-25S-316
- Length: 12cm (4.6 in)
- Outside Diameter (OD): 25mm
- Inside Diameter (ID): 2.05mm
- Application: Soft Tissue Resection
Sterilization
- Device Packaged as Sterile: Yes
- Requires Sterilization Prior to Use: No
- Single-Use, Disposable

- FDA Product Code: LFL
- FDA Product Code Name: Instrument, ultrasonic surgical
- GMDN Term Code: 44755
- GMDN Term Name: Soft-tissue ultrasonic surgical system handpiece tip, single-use
- GMDN Term Definition: A sterile removable endpiece intended to be attached to an ultrasonic surgical system handpiece, and makes contact with a patient while oscillating (vibrating) at high frequency in order to fragment soft-tissue cells for cutting and/or coagulating tissue during surgery. The device comes in a variety of forms (e.g., blade, cylinder, pincers) and sizes, and is typically made of metal; it is not intended to be held directly (i.e., does not include a holder). This device is utilized in a variety of surgical disciplines (e.g., neurosurgery, general surgery, surgical oncology, gynaecology, and urology). This is a single-use device.
